The Sàrl is a legal entity with legal capacity. It can be formed by one or more individuals or legal entities, regardless of nationality or place of residence.
The minimum share capital required is 20,000 CHF, fully paid up from the outset. This capital can be in cash or, under certain conditions, in kind.
The partners are registered in the Commercial Register, which ensures transparency regarding their identity. In return, their liability is strictly limited to the amount of their participation. Therefore, the personal assets of the partners are protected.
The management of the Sàrl is handled by one or more managers, who can be chosen from among the partners or be external third parties. In accordance with Swiss legislation, at least one manager with signing authority must reside in Switzerland.

The Sàrl is required to maintain complete accounting, produce annual accounts, and comply with the tax deadlines imposed by Swiss law.
The Sàrl offers a solid, accessible, and adaptable legal framework. It is particularly suitable for entrepreneurs who wish to protect themselves from risks associated with their activity while maintaining flexible management.
The main advantages include the protection of personal assets, accessibility of minimum capital, the possibility of creating the company alone or with others, clarity in the distribution of shares, enhanced credibility with banks and business partners, as well as good adaptability to all sectors of activity, including consulting, commerce, services, and innovation.
Like any legal structure, the Sàrl also has certain limitations. The identity of the partners being public can be a hindrance for those who wish to remain discreet. Governance is subject to collective decisions based on shareholdings, which can slow down some operational choices. Accounting obligations are more demanding than for a sole proprietorship. Finally, profit distributions are subject to withholding tax, as with all capital companies.
